What is Sustainable Packaging Design? A Reality Check
The day we cycled the RecycleSmart run on the decommissioned corrugator line at our Riverside plant, the metrics on the floor told the story before the boardroom did: what is sustainable packaging design if it doesn’t slice 60% of loose plastic from a single SKU’s bundle while keeping four layers of stacking strength? The line operators had already reused the stretch wrapper from a past run, yet the savings came from the new inline sensor logic we installed with Plant Engineering West out of Phoenix for $18,500, with the commissioning crew booked for the 12-15 business days we negotiated up front so the humidity reports were live before the next shift. I still hear the shift supervisor laughing as the savings spreadsheet flashed a four-figure weekly gain; that moment made the keyword a concrete measurable outcome on the shop floor.
In technical terms, what is sustainable packaging design becomes the design thinking that balances fiber science, logistics, and brand expectations so that every fiber source, ink chemistry, and closure method supports the circular economy instead of just creating a prettier package. At our Greensboro hub, approving mineral-based ink swatches that hit the 2.8 gloss delta while still meeting the 350gsm C1S specs keeps the premium SKUs honest. We rely on life-cycle assessments aligned to ASTM D6866 for biobased content and the FSC chain-of-custody numbers from our suppliers, and the brief references those metrics before sketches begin. When a printer wants a solvent-heavy varnish we play the recycler card, moving forward only once the coating clears the regrind assay in our lab.
We’ve learned the hard way that what is sustainable packaging design cannot be a vague aspirational label. During the CleanCorr board certification audit in Riverside we asked the team to list every test for recycled pulp performance; their checklist—tensile at 26 kg-force, Elmendorf tear at 3.4 newtons, brightness at 60 GE—became the baseline for legitimate claims rather than marketing fluff. The purchasing lead sat through that with the auditors and marked the tests we already run, so the next supplier call shifted from “trust us” to “show me the tensile, tear, and brightness numbers from your October batch.” I keep that auditor’s spreadsheet pinned to the wall as a reminder that flattery doesn’t pass the test bench.
Ultimately, what is sustainable packaging design is the tension between measurable performance and honest storytelling. When it’s grounded in real data from the shop floor, the conversation stays practical, not poetic.
How Sustainable Packaging Design Works in Practice: what is sustainable packaging design on the line
The answer to what is sustainable packaging design requires walking through every layer: product protection, warehousing, automation, and last-mile performance. At our Midwest corrugator in Columbus, Ohio, materials managers capture the top three damage points per SKU by running the ISTA 6-Amazon drop pattern with 25-pound test weights and sharing the data with Quality Control before any changes are approved. That data combines with pallet racking info from Chicago; a 30% height change on a pallet can reduce handling damage more than switching tray material, so design begins by mapping those real points and letting the damage vortex guide the fiber choice.
I pull the warehouse manager into those conversations because she can show me camera footage of forklifts clobbering a stack when a pack is off-spec. Yes, I’ve started bringing popcorn to those meetings because the footage is that dramatic. The visceral reminder of real-world abuse keeps everyone respectful of what protective performance actually does.
When buyers finally understand what is sustainable packaging design means optimizing the touchpoints where product meets customer hands—whether it’s a retail display or a fulfillment box—the conversation shifts. At the Midwest thermoforming lab in Aurora, Illinois, we replaced single-use polyethylene trays with hybrid pulp-foam modules. Moisture chamber tests (85% relative humidity for 48 hours) and finite-element drop analysis proved they met specs with 35% less resin, trimming tray weight from 0.55 to 0.35 pounds. That's engineering data, not wishful thinking; it shows what what is sustainable packaging design looks like on the floor. I bring the finance lead there so she can feel the tray, hear why it doesn’t crack around 95°F, and stop asking if recycled material is just marketing nonsense.

Key Factors Driving Sustainable Packaging Design Choices: what is sustainable packaging design guiding suppliers
When clients visit the boardroom, I break what is sustainable packaging design into four pillars: material sourcing, recyclability, production energy, and end-of-life systems. At our Custom Logo Things sites in Portland and Sacramento, we score each pillar per SKU so a lightweight corrugate, molded pulp, or reusable crate is selected for the right reasons. For windows-bound electronics, we sometimes pay $0.18 more per unit for 350gsm C1S with soft-touch lamination, keeping the FSC mix and preserving the printed finish customers expect. I show them the supplier invoice, plug it into the circularity dashboard, and suddenly they stop staring at price tags and start asking how that finish survives recycling. One client asked, “So the gloss survives without being a pain?” I smirked, “Yes, but only after we audited the varnish lab three times.”
Suppliers like GreenFiber in Cleveland and EcoPoly in Louisville matter because they open their stream-level data so we can compare reclaimed pulp from Cleveland versus FSC-certified virgin pulp delivered via rail in ten days. That transparency allows the precise trade-offs what is sustainable packaging design demands; we quantify whether the reclaimed streams meet tensile requirements instead of guessing. I’ve even started carrying sample rolls into client meetings so folks can feel the weight difference and tie it back to circular-economy rationale. It also keeps the negotiating table honest—when a supplier hints at long lead time I counter with our plant’s steady 68% recycling yield. (Yes, I now pack samples like a traveling fiber salesman.)
Regulatory curves keep us on our toes. Compostability claims must sync with municipal programs tracked on epa.gov, including the 28 cities listed in the Q2 2023 update. A package that theoretically composts overseas still sits in a landfill locally if infrastructure is missing. That gap damages the credibility of what is sustainable packaging design, so before each launch we gather compliance, logistics, and sales to review curbside streams in Seattle, Denver, and Austin. Step-by-Step Guide and Timeline for Sustainable Packaging Design: what is sustainable packaging design at each phase
Phase 1—Discovery (Weeks 1-2)—begins with asking what is sustainable packaging design for your SKU: reduce grams, bump recycled content, or prep for reuse? We inventory materials, waste streams, and customer requirements, anchoring the process with that keyword on every kickoff slide. Our Riverside sustainability analyst tracks current packaging-to-product ratios so we know baseline grams per shipper for later comparison, logging figures into the ERP by Friday afternoon. I usually end those workshops with the purchasing lead calling the main fiber supplier to confirm they can deliver the recycled blend without sacrificing the 14-day lead time. If the answer to “what is sustainable packaging design” doesn’t survive a supplier call, we haven’t defined it clearly enough.
Phase 2—Concept (Weeks 3-4)—is where the prototyping lab uses digital twins to explore options. Design engineers evaluate volume reduction, nestability, recyclability targets, and reference what is sustainable packaging design in every CAD comment. The team tests new custom printed boxes on the robotic case erector and watches how they stack on the automated warehouse pallet; if a design upsets the conveyors, it stops here. We aim for five mock-ups per week to make informed decisions before tooling budgets are set. The robotics crew times each run so we never approve a design that forces a conveyor slowdown—still hear the clanging from the display case we let choke the shuttle arm at 42 units per minute.
Phase 3—Validation (Weeks 5-6)—aligns prototype data with production realities. Pilot runs occur on the press floor; drop tests happen in our ISTA lab with 50 cycles per SKU; packaging technologists compare noise, shock, and humidity data to what we predicted. We ask what is sustainable packaging design again to prove the prototype meets technical and storytelling requirements. Small batch test orders move through the ERP to ensure traceability and log the material mix for future reporting. The shipping team sends samples through the DC to confirm how the carton behaves at retail racks or fulfillment sorters.
Phase 4—Rollout (Weeks 7 and beyond)—covers supplier alignment, regulatory filings, and customer training. I remind the team that what is sustainable packaging design isn’t complete until the new pack is live with the distributor and the customer-facing team can describe the change, usually via a training call scheduled for the first Monday after launch. We align supplier contracts, confirm packaging labeling meets local recycling mandates, and set up dashboards tracking grams-per-shipper and recyclability scores so the work doesn’t stall once cartons ship. Those dashboards feed finance so they can see sustainability KPIs that justify the investment.
Common Mistakes in Sustainable Packaging Design: what is sustainable packaging design lacking when we slip
One mistake is assuming certification equals the right mix. We once greenlit a poly-laminated liner without verifying post-consumer content. When the buyer asked for recycled percentages, the supplier couldn’t provide them, and the SKU sat in transit for nine days while compliance chased missing data. That eroded the meaning of what is sustainable packaging design and created a compliance headache. Always validate the reclaiming infrastructure for the material stream before committing—shiny percentages mean nothing if the local recycling center can’t process them. That meeting still hangs on my calendar as a reminder to ask for the mill’s reconciliation report before signing anything. (The supplier’s excuse that their finance system “just didn’t track it” would make a great fiction book.)
Another error is ignoring automation. Beautiful, full-color retail packaging might look great, but when gloss film sticks at conveyor speeds above 40 units per minute, manual taping kills any sustainability gains. When we revisit what is sustainable packaging design, automation reviews are baked in. If a design jams a servo or needs extra labor, the net sustainability impact can go negative. Now the automation crew signs off on every prototype, referencing the 10-second cycle time target they captured on their tablets.
Cutting protective performance to save material is a third pitfall. We once dropped kraft board from 350gsm to 280gsm for a cost target, only to see damage spike 25% and return costs climb $11,200 over six weeks. That’s when we doubled down on what is sustainable packaging design by bringing protection back—true sustainability balances material reduction with performance. Damage reports rolled in for weeks, and I had to explain why the price hike still made sense once returns stopped. I muttered loud enough for the conference room that this was why we had a QA team and not a dream team.
Lastly, skipping detailed supplier contracts about end-of-life handling leaves logistics partners guessing. We now require language that defines bin streams, reclamation procedures, and terminology tied to what is sustainable packaging design. Consistent terminology prevents messy handoffs, so procurement through shipping knows what the new footprint means. If a supplier balks, I remind them that precise language makes the compliance audit scheduled for the last Tuesday of the quarter much easier.

Understanding Costs and Pricing Signals in Sustainable Packaging Design: what is sustainable packaging design reveals about investments
Cost components for what is sustainable packaging design include fiber premiums, tooling tweaks, and surface treatments. Using 100% recycled corrugate might raise raw material bills by $0.02 to $0.05 per board foot, but we recoup the difference via rebates from waste diversion partners and by stacking boxes more efficiently so shipments shrink by 15%. The key is never to treat the price change as a line-item alone; pair it with downstream savings the material shift generates. I make sure the cost deck includes those downstream levers before sitting with procurement.
The pricing desk tracks comparative bids for sustainable and conventional options. A 5,000-piece batch of custom printed boxes with virgin fiber might run $0.68 per unit, while the recycled version sits at $0.73. The recycled run often qualifies for a $0.04 rebate after the waste stream is verified, turning the net difference into $0.69—effectively cost-neutral when you include handling and diverted freight savings. Procurement then presents a neutral hit to the CFO while still telling the sustainability story.
Long-term savings also come from lighter shipments, fewer returns due to better pallet stability, and retail partners appreciating transparent reporting. Once you reconcile the initial investment with downstream efficiencies, the real price of what is sustainable packaging design becomes a blended figure rather than a sharp premium. The logistics director now tracks how many more cases fit per truck, crediting the new design for at least one fewer trailer a week.
Building scenario models with procurement answers the crucial question: at what volume does the sustainable approach break even or become profitable? We compare price points across volumes and factor in rebates, showing stakeholders that the cost signature improves with scale, encouraging bigger commitments to new materials. I drop those models into the quarterly business review so the sales lead can see what a 20,000-piece run buys back in rebates and lower freight.
| Option | Material | Unit Price (5,000 pcs) | Additional Fees | Notes |
|---|---|---|---|---|
| Standard Corrugate | Virgin Kraft, 350gsm | $0.68 | $250 tooling | Used for high-end retail packaging |
| Recycled Corrugate | 100% Reclaimed, 330gsm | $0.73 | $250 tooling + $120 FSC audit | Qualifies for $0.04 rebate after weigh-in |
| Pulp Molded | Molded Pulp/PVA blend | $0.89 | $420 mold investment | Ideal for protective inserts, reduces weight by 12% |

How does sustainable packaging design differ from traditional packaging design?
Traditional packaging design emphasizes protection and aesthetics, whereas sustainable packaging design prioritizes life-cycle impacts, circular materials, and end-of-life infrastructure, including the municipal compost programs in Portland and Austin that we align with for our food clients. I remind the design team every time that the most beautiful pack still fails if it ends up in a landfill with no plan for reuse.
What materials are commonly used in sustainable packaging design?
Recyclable corrugate, molded pulp, compostable films, and mineral-based inks are staples because they align with recycling streams and performance requirements, and we require suppliers to show us their 12-month mill reconciliation reports before orders ship. I also keep a stash on site so procurement can prove the fibers behave the way the spec sheet promises.
Can sustainable packaging design work with automated production lines?
Yes, by validating new designs on existing conveyors and labeling systems you ensure sustainable packaging design integrates without slowing automation or increasing labor. The automation team now brings a stopwatch to every pilot run to capture cycle time before the design goes live. They log results in the MES, so every new run is traceable back to a specific SKU and speed.
How do you measure the success of sustainable packaging design efforts?
Track material reduction, recyclability rate, waste diversion, customer returns, and total cost of ownership to quantify the impact. During quarterly reviews I overlay those metrics with sales feedback so the story stays rooted in customer experience—especially when the return rate drops more than 6% after a new design rollout.
How should brands communicate their sustainable packaging design progress to customers?
Use honest, specific claims tied to certifications or test results, explain trade-offs, and show how sustainable packaging design supports broader corporate responsibility goals. We even send a recap to buyers with the latest test reports so they see the data themselves, such as the 72% recycled content and 15% weight drop tracked last quarter.
